Popular Water Heater Systems and Their Positive Aspects

When considering water heater choices, homeowners typically find a variety of types, each presenting distinct advantages that address different needs. Conventional tank water heaters are favored for their ability to store hot water, making them ideal for larger households. They are usually less expensive at first but may generate higher energy costs over time.

In contrast, tankless water heaters supply hot water on demand, resulting in energy savings and the convenience of never running out of hot water. They are small and perfect for smaller spaces.

Heat pump systems leverage electricity to move heat, delivering substantial energy efficiency in mild climates. Solar water heaters harness sunlight, reducing utility bills and environmental impact but may require a higher upfront investment.

Every variety delivers specific benefits, permitting homeowners to choose a system that corresponds to their particular usage patterns and energy efficiency goals.

How to Know When to Replace Your Water Heater?

What are the indicators that a water heater requires replacement? Homeowners should be vigilant for several key indicators. To begin with, the unit's age is a major factor; average water heaters operate between 8 to 12 years. Should a unit reach or go beyond this timeframe, replacement must be contemplated. Secondly, visible leaks or accumulated water near the bottom indicates possible malfunction. Furthermore, fluctuating water temperatures or reduced hot water availability might signal internal problems. Oxidized or murky water is another caution indicator, signaling deterioration inside the tank. Additionally, unusual noises, such as popping or rumbling sounds, often point to sediment buildup or mechanical failure. Lastly, rising energy costs could indicate poor efficiency, requiring thorough examination. Identifying these indicators can assist property owners in preventing sudden breakdowns and maintaining dependable hot water access.

Routine Flushing Method

Regularly flushing a water heater is essential for ensuring its optimal performance and longevity. Eventually, sediment accumulation and mineral deposits may form at the tank's base, causing reduced performance and possible harm. To carry out a flush, one should commence by turning off the gas or power supply to the heater. Next, the cold water line is closed, and a hose is fastened to the drain valve, channeling water to a appropriate disposal area. Activating the drain valve allows the contaminated water to drain. It is advisable to periodically check the flushing process, ensuring all sediment is removed. Completing this upkeep activity at least annually can substantially boost the water heater's operational life and effectiveness.

Temperature Configuration Changes

Modifying the temperature setting of a water heater is vital for both energy efficiency and comfort. Most experts advise setting the thermostat between 120°F and 140°F. This range provides adequate hot water while reducing energy costs and lowering the risk of scalding. Regular inspections of the temperature can help preserve optimal performance; if the water is consistently too hot or too cold, adjustments may be required. Moreover, insulation around the tank and pipes can improve efficiency, keeping water warm longer. Homeowners should also be aware that seasonal changes may demand temperature adjustments to ensure consistent comfort throughout the year. Implementing these simple adjustments can considerably lengthen the life of the water heater and enhance overall household energy use.

What Is the Average Duration for a Water Heater Installation?

A standard water heater installation generally takes between two and four hours, contingent upon factors like the style of heater, existing plumbing connections, and any additional modifications needed for proper installation and setup.

Can I Install a Water Heater Myself?

Self-installation of a water heater is achievable for those with proper plumbing and electrical understanding. Nevertheless, local codes and safety standards must be followed, making professional installation a more dependable and generally safer choice.

What Permits Do You Need for Water Heater Setup?

Usually, permits necessary for water heater installation include a plumbing permit and occasionally electrical permits, according to local regulations. Homeowners should contact their local building authority to ensure compliance with all applicable codes and requirements.

How Do I Determine the Proper Size Water Heater for My Home?

To identify the proper size water heater, you should examine the number of people in your home, peak water usage, and particular equipment needs. Figuring out the essential gallons per minute will help determine an adequate capacity for optimal hot water provision.

What Warranty Options Come with Installed Water Heaters?

Multiple warranties are available for installed water heaters, normally ranging from 6 to 12 years. These warranties might cover labor, parts, and tank leaks, according to the manufacturer and specific model chosen by the homeowner.
